在android中我们可以直接添加toast。他们有什么方法可以在iOS中添加类似的toast吗?我创建了透明View以用作toast,但对于多种文本大小,我必须创建多个View。 最佳答案 iOS中没有Android类型的Toast控件。如果你想使用类似的东西,你需要用UILabel自定义UIView,或者使用一些已经创建好的Toast类型的组件,如下:AndroidTypeToastcustom 关于ios-如何在iOS中添加androidliketoast?,我们在StackOve
我想用Hive替换Hadoop作业。我的挑战是在Hadoop中,我正在使用setup()通过从分布式缓存中读取引用数据(兴趣点)来构建kdtree。然后我在map()中使用kdtree来评估目标数据与kdtree的距离。在Hive中,我想使用带有evaluate()方法的udf来确定距离,但我不知道如何使用引用数据设置kdtree。这可能吗? 最佳答案 我可能没有完整的答案,所以我只是提出一些可能有帮助的想法。您可以使用ADDFILE...将文件添加到hive中的分布式缓存Hive11+(我认为)应该允许您访问GenericUDF.
我需要使用regex_extract从列中的字符串中提取数字。我在外部表上使用Impala。我已经检查了正则表达式,为了测试它,我还使用了regexp_like和regexp_replace。他们两个都工作得很完美。这里是查询:selectsucursal,regexp_like(sucursal,'^[0-9]{1,3}')asmatch,regexp_extract(sucursal,'^[0-9]{1,3}',1)asCodSucusal,regexp_replace(sucursal,'^[0-9]{1,3}','lala')asRepCodSucusalfromjdv.stg
我想使用CASEWHEN、LIKE和正则表达式在配置单元表中编写查询。我使用了regexp和rlike,但我没有得到想要的结果。到目前为止,我的尝试如下selectdistinctendingfrom(selectdate,ending,name,count(distinctid)from(selectCONCAT_WS("/",year,month,day,hour)asdate,id,name,casewhentype='TRAN'then'tran'wheneventsregexp'%[:]no_reply[:]%[^o][^n][:]incomplete[:]%'andtype
我正在尝试(INNER)使用RLIKE连接Hive中的两个表。selecta.col_x,b.col_y,count(*)asnfromtableAajointableBbONa.col_xRLIKEconcat('^',b.col_z)groupbya.col_x,b.col_y(表A约100M条记录,表B约1k条记录)此查询将不起作用,因为Hive仅支持相等连接。我将不等式移至where子句(引用:ErrorinHiveQuerywhilejoiningtables)。selecta.col_x,b.col_y,count(*)asnfromtableAa,tableBbWHERE
您好,我有一个HashSet,它需要在hadoop中的每个映射任务中使用。我不想多次初始化它。我听说可以通过在配置函数中设置变量来实现。欢迎提出任何建议。 最佳答案 看来你还没有真正了解Hadoop的执行策略。如果你是分布式模式,你不能在多个map任务中共享一个集合(HashSet)。这是因为任务是在它们自己的JVM中执行的,并且它不是确定性的,即使不使用jvm重用,你的集合在jvm被重置后仍然存在。您可以做的是在计算开始时为每个任务设置一个HashSet。因此您可以覆盖setup(Contextctx)方法。这将在调用映射方法之前
我正在尝试在CrudRepository中创建一个方法,该方法能够为我提供用户列表,其用户名类似于输入参数(不仅以输入参数开头,而且还包含它)。我尝试使用方法"findUserByUsernameLike(@Param("username")Stringusername)"但正如Spring文档中所述,此方法等于“user.usernamelike?1”。这对我不好,因为我已经告诉过我正在尝试获取用户名包含的所有用户...我为该方法编写了一个查询,但它甚至没有部署。@RepositorypublicinterfaceUserRepositoryextendsCrudRepository
我正在尝试在CrudRepository中创建一个方法,该方法能够为我提供用户列表,其用户名类似于输入参数(不仅以输入参数开头,而且还包含它)。我尝试使用方法"findUserByUsernameLike(@Param("username")Stringusername)"但正如Spring文档中所述,此方法等于“user.usernamelike?1”。这对我不好,因为我已经告诉过我正在尝试获取用户名包含的所有用户...我为该方法编写了一个查询,但它甚至没有部署。@RepositorypublicinterfaceUserRepositoryextendsCrudRepository
我正在尝试设置一些简单的SQL脚本来帮助进行一些短期数据库管理。因此,我正在设置变量以尝试更轻松地重用这些脚本。我遇到的问题是LIKE子句。SET@email='test@test.com';SELECTemailfrom`user`WHEREemailLIKE'%@email%';所以我想让它根据变量中的电子邮件SET查找结果。如果我在LIKE子句中手动输入电子邮件,则查询有效。如何让LIKE子句与用户变量一起使用?更新:@dems的答案适用于这个简单的案例,但我在处理更复杂的查询时遇到了麻烦。SET@email='test@test.com';SELECTproject.proje
我正在尝试设置一些简单的SQL脚本来帮助进行一些短期数据库管理。因此,我正在设置变量以尝试更轻松地重用这些脚本。我遇到的问题是LIKE子句。SET@email='test@test.com';SELECTemailfrom`user`WHEREemailLIKE'%@email%';所以我想让它根据变量中的电子邮件SET查找结果。如果我在LIKE子句中手动输入电子邮件,则查询有效。如何让LIKE子句与用户变量一起使用?更新:@dems的答案适用于这个简单的案例,但我在处理更复杂的查询时遇到了麻烦。SET@email='test@test.com';SELECTproject.proje